Product Description:
Pericom Semiconductor’s PI5C series of logic circuits are
produced in the Company’s advanced 0.8 micron CMOS technology,
achieving industry leading performance.
The PI5C32245 is a 8-bit, 2-port bus switch designed with a low
ON resistance (5
) allowing inputs to be connected directly to
outputs. The bus switch creates no additional propagational delay
or additional ground bounce noise. The switches are turned ON by
the Bus Enable (BE) input signal. Pinout is compatible with
PI74FCT245T (Octal Bidirectional Transceiver). The device has a
built-in 25
resistor to reduce noise resulting from reflections, thus
eliminating the need for an external terminating resistor.
